World
premieres:I version for
flute: Wiesbaden, 1972II
version for piano: Nyon,
1972III version for var.
insts.: Cologne, May 29,
1976VI version for
accordeon: Fribourg, June
25, 1987VIII version for
violoncello Tokyo:
October 14, 1989X version
for organ: Stuttgart,
March 28, 2018This work
(A Breath of the
Untimely) was first
written for solo Flute
and dedicated to Aurele
Nicolet. Its bears the
subtitle Lament on the
Loss of Musical Thought -
some Madrigals for Solo
Flute or Flute with any
other Instruments. This
serves as a playing
instruction but doubles
at the same time as an
outmoded programme: it
refers back to the
musical origin of the
opening lamenting motif,
a tradition which was
once of its time but is
not of our time - namely
the Lamento genre which
gave the title to the
Chaconne in Purcell's
opera Dido and Aeneas.
Almost simultaneously I
wrote a second version
for Piano (for Piano
one-and-a-half hands),
which already formulates
possible approaches for
the performer, in some
detail, to the indicated,
quasi-canonic version of
the piece in the
programme. The multiple
version Ein Hauch von
Unzeit III realizes a
concrete version of a
formal state which floats
between strict canon and
aleatoric principles:
each of the musicians who
are spread throughout the
hall introduces their own
idiomatic translation of
the flute part. And so
the music exists,
omnipresent, not only
spatially throughout the
hall, but also formally
in a sort of fluctuating
simultaneity. For that
reason, it was my express
wish to any potential
interpreter that they
should construct entirely
their own version of the
piece. A healthy number
of musicians have
responded to my
suggestion - versions of
the piece have now been
made for guitar
(Cornelius Schwehr,
Gunther Schneider),
accordion (Hugo Noth),
double bass (Fernando
Grillo), violin
(Hansheinz Schneeberger),
viola, violoncello, and
double bass (trio basso,
Koln), violoncello
(Michael Bach), trombone
(Andrew Digby) and,
created by myself, a sung
version for voice (to
words by Georg Wilhelm
Friedrich Hegel und Max
Bense), and for viola.The
most important
requirement for the whole
piece is absolute
stillness, which should
as far as possible
emanate from the
performer. The pauses are
occasionally in this
respect the most
important element. These
may, if one can find the
necessary stillness,
become very long.Ein
Hauch von Unzeit (A
Breath of the Untimely) -
time almost
dissolves!(Klaus Huber,

Composer's
Note When I considered
the ensemble of eight
cellos, I first thought
of matt and dark
textures. I also wanted
to go back to some ideas
on symmetry. While I was
pondering all that, I saw
snow flakes falling from
the dark sky of the
Finnish autumn. Focusing
on the snow, the idea of
writing variations on it
and its various forms
became clearer in my
mind.Nuages de neige is a
uniform and linear
texture in which I
realise my first
impressions of that
ensemble. The two Etoiles
de neige are based on the
idea of symmetry and
repetition: the first one
develops up to a certain
point where it doubles
back as in a mirror
image, the second one
consists of eight
sections in which the
harmonic structure is
repeated, as well as a
linear gesture that
becomes ever more
present. Aguilles de
glace focuses on
different pizzicati and
superimposed ostinati.
With Fleurs de neige I
sought to recall the
texture of those harmonic
trills at the end of the
first section, although
more airy and diversified
here. Kaija Saariaho.

“Gor
don Wright was the friend
of a lifetime. For thirty
years Gordon and I shared
our two greatest
passions: music and
Alaska. Gordon was my
musical collaborator, my
next-door neighbor, my
fellow environmentalist
and my camping buddy.
These miniatures are
musical sketches of three
moments and places in our
friendship. Like Alaska,
Gordon was larger than
life. He always lived his
own way. And he died just
as he would have wanted.
We found him lying on the
deck of his cabin in the
Chugach Mountains, curled
up against his favorite
birch tree, looking
across the waters of
Turnagain Arm toward the
Resurrection Valley and
the tiny settlement of
Hope.” - John
Luther Adams
This
music contains no normal
stopped tones. All the
sounds are produced as
natural harmonics or on
open strings. There are
no harmonics higher than
the sixth. So these
sounds should be clear
and resonant. Even so,
balancing the harmonics
with the open strings
requires careful
attention.
The
durations of the
individual pieces are
given at the end of
each.
The total
duration of the set is
about ten minutes.

Written for
Moray Welsh whilst still
an undergraduate at York
University. This piece
was completed in
mid-September. Inspired
by Hermann Hesse's
Steppenwolf. A solo
'cello seemed an
appropriate medium for
music which might explore
the character of Harry
Haller, with his desire
for bourgeois comfort and
his strong misanthropic
and suicidal tendencies.
The opening theme
attempts to express this
- melancholy, nostalgic,
a bit Biedermeyer (cf.
Brahms Intermezzi). The
basic theme of the book,
at its simplest, is that
every human personality
consists of hundred of
different personalities -
within every man there
lurks a wolf. Accordingly
the tendency of my piece
is for all its musical
material to become
distorted, either by
thematic transformation
or by changes of timbre.
There are three movements
played without a break.
The first is a character
portrait of the
Steppenwolf. The second
is concerned in the most
general sort of way with
the dance elements in the
novel - Harry's being
taught to dance and
appreciate low 'popular'
music - a tango is
recapitulated in a waltz
and 'Yearning', a popular
song of the time (1927)
is hinted at. The third
movement concerns the
Masked Ball and the Magic
Theatre. Mozart is one of
Hesse's great loves and
he is repeatedly
mentioned in the book.
Inevitably some Mozart
quotes have been worked
in, the most significant
being a reference to The
Magic Flute 'fire and
water' flute theme in the
middle of the second
movement. Long before I
finished the piece, I was
disenchanted with the
work of Hesse. Much of
Steppenwolf I now find
rather embarrassing and
the claims currently made
for Hesse's greatness
seem to me exaggerated.
Since my piece is in no
important sense
programmatically
specific, this change of
heart doesn't really
matter. ~ David
Blake.

Robert
Lindley
(1776–1855) was
the premier cellist in
England for more than 50
years. In 1822 he became
the first professor of
cello at the Royal
Academy of Music in
London, where he remained
until his retirement in
1851. Lindley, an
esteemed and much
sought-after teacher,
wrote not only the
present
“Capricciosâ€
but also a cello method,
several concertos, and
chamber music in which
the cello is prominently
featured.
The
“Capriccios and
Exercises†contain
a multitude of fingering
patterns in related major
and minor harmonies,
exercises for the thumb
position and many
passages of double stops,
all within a melodious
framework.

“[Bach's]
six unaccompanied cello
suites bring together
three voices - two upper
voices and a bass - into
one line. If so, the
Goldberg Variations,
which have the same
structure, might also be
reproduced for
unaccompanied cello. This
sudden idea led me to the
arrangement of the piece.
Of course, it is
impossible to reproduce
every single note, but I
aimed to arrange it in a
way that all the notes
would sound in our mind.
When combining the three
lines into one, the most
crucial consideration
was, 'What would Bach
do?' I carefully read
materials and scores,
repeatedly listened to
recordings, performed my
arrangement in concerts,
and revised it over and
over. That time was not
painful, but pure joy,
and it was a time to
immerse myself in 'being
Bach.' It is no
exaggeration to say that
it was more a time of
recreation rather than
arrangement. The
articulations and slurs
are fundamentally based
on the facsimile of the
first edition (the
edition by Anne Fuzeau
Productions) that Bach
himself owned. It is a
highly credible edition
with corrections in red
written by Bach.”

'Brice
Catherin, a cellist and a
composer exploring the
notion of the
one-man-band concept,
commissioned this work;
this composition was
subsequently the result
of our collaboration. My
aim has been to create a
work where the cellist
produces sounds using his
full body: his hands
(employing a variety of
extended techniques on
the Cello and external
objects), his feet, his
mouth (singing and
playing the harmonica and
flexible tube) and even
his face on one occasion
to muffle the strings.
There are two central
themes in the work:
virtuosity and theatre,
both strong, frequent
features of my
compositional oeuvre.
After several meetings
and experimentation with
Brice, I chose asetup
that enhances the musical
scope without visually
cluttering the stage. I
am also using a rather
unusual scordatura that
not only changes the
timbre of the instrument
itself, but also helps
create unique soundscapes
that blend together with
the sounds from the
spring drums, the human
voice (whistling, groans
and other effects), a
singing bowl, a harmonica
and a flexible tube among
others. The work is
entitled Emmelia and
there are two reasons for
this: Emmelia derives
from the prefix en (in)
and the noun melos
(harmony), thus meaning
in harmony. The
composition is structured
and developed in clearly
defined sections (noisy,
harmonious, distorted,
etc.), based on
information revealed by a
spectral analysis of an
F1 spectrum on the cello
(tuned a fifth below low
C), played and recorded
using a variety of
attacks and triggering
objects and methods.
Emmelia is also the name
of my baby daughter, who
has been my constant
inspiration since she was
born.' - Evis
Sammoutis.

Vier Seiten
for violoncello is an
attempt to present an
event that in reality
takes about two seconds
in extreme slow motion,
thus making even the
micromovements visible or
audible beyond the
straight line of
motion.When I composed
the piece, the fatal
accident of Ayrton Senna
came to my mind again and
again - an accident which
was shown on TV in slow
motion again and again
until it became
unbearable. The fast
motion of the car
immediately before the
crash into a concrete
wall, a motion which was
no longer purposeful but
out of control and which
had the car pulled to and
fro and from side to
side, was followed by
that crash. In this
extreme slow motion, it
is no longer shown as a
crash but as the fast
telescoping of carbon
fibre, metal and human
body parts.After this
crash, as a postlude so
to speak, everything
suddenly slowed down,
tyres and automotive
particles floating in the
air, the torso of the
vehicle swinging until
the motion stopped. It
was not until this moment
that I realized that the
whole presentation of the
incident had been
accompanied by paralyzing
silence.- Thomas
Larcher

Manfred
Trojahn on the origin and
title of his impressive
virtuoso solo
work: Admittedly I do
not know if he had
seagulls, but since
Mendelssohn was born in
Hamburg, he will not have
gone through life without
at least the impression
of the cry of seagulls.
Nor do I know if seagulls
played any part in his
life in Rome. I myself
was astonished when, one
or two years ago in the
Villa Massimo, I was, not
exactly annoyed but
disturbed by the strong
rhythmical cry of
seagulls. I was just
about to write a bassoon
solo when the seagulls
started. Then the
idea came to me that
precisely this sequence
of notes could serve as
the basis of the work.
And the sequence for the
bassoon solo is, in turn,
the basis of the piece
for violoncello - this is
how titles are born... Of
course the violoncello
meanders with virtuosic
ease from the seagull
motif to the 'elf-like'
skittering brought to
music by Mendelssohn and
used time and again in
his compositions, finally
becoming a cabaletta.
Now, cabalettas are not
very representative of
Mendelssohn, but as I was
composing I definitely
wanted to put a cabaletta
in this passage. I am
sure Mendelssohn and I
will easily agree on
this, especially since
later justice is done to
him in the rapid passages
and, of course in the
tonal cadenza at the very
end, which is more
indicative of his time
than of mine ... isn't
it?
